Author Joseph Di Prisco will visit the Toadstool Bookshop today, July 14, at 4 p.m. to discuss his new book.
In conversation with David Robins, Di Prisco will talk about his latest novel “The Alzhammer.” He and Robins were college roommates, a distant time ago. Robins is the retired minister of the Unitarian Universalist Church in Peterborough.
The “alzhammer,” as he calls it, afflicts Mickey, a once-powerful mob boss. He is seriously slipping, losing control of his crew and of his mind. His business is sideways, his rivals are coming for him, he’s crazy forgetful, and it is a fact his parents suffered miserably with Alzheimer’s. He refuses to ride diapered and drooling into the sunset.
